Detailed explanation-1: -Adding contaminated foods to non-contaminated foods results in food-to-food cross contamination. This allows harmful bacteria to spread and populate ( 6 ).

Detailed explanation-2: -All food is at risk of one of the four types of contamination: chemical, microbial, physical, and allergenic.

Detailed explanation-3: -using the same knife or chopping board to cut both raw and ready-to-eat foods. using the handwash basin for defrosting food or placing dirty utensils and equipment. storing food uncovered or on the floor of the fridge or freezer. storing raw food above ready-to-eat food.
